This unit

The Stanford Research SIM914 is a dual-channel, DC-coupled preamplifier delivering 5× voltage gain (14 dB) per channel across a DC to 350 MHz bandwidth. Engineered for precision amplification of weak signals from photodiodes, photomultiplier tubes, and similar detectors, the SIM914 achieves 6.4 nV/√Hz input noise with excellent phase linearity and fast signal integrity. Each channel operates independently with 50 Ω input and output impedance, ±200 mV input range, and ±1 V output range.


Rise and fall times are 1 ns (bandwidth limited), with 2.7 ns propagation delay and 3 ns overload recovery for 10× overdrive. The module integrates into the SIM900 Mainframe via DB15/M connector or operates standalone with external +5 V DC power.


Technical Specifications



  • Bandwidth: DC to 350 MHz

  • Voltage Gain: 5 per channel (14 dB); cascadable to 25× (28 dB) across two modules

  • Input Noise: 6.4 nV/√Hz typical; 80 µVrms broadband (1 Hz to 300 MHz)

  • Input Impedance: 50 Ω, DC coupled

  • Output Impedance: 50 Ω, DC coupled

  • Input Operating Range: ±200 mV; DC limit ±4 V

  • Output Operating Range: ±1 V with ±1.6 V clamp voltage

  • Rise/Fall Time: 1 ns; 1.3 ns into 50 Ω load

  • Propagation Delay: 2.7 ns typical

  • Overload Recovery: 3 ns for 10× overdrive

  • Input Protection: ±50 V transients (<1 µs)

  • Crosstalk: −60 dB

  • Channels: 2 independent


Key Features



  • Excellent phase linearity across entire frequency range

  • Output overload detection threshold at ±1.3 V

  • Peak-to-peak noise typically 5× rms value (~10 mVpp output, dual cascaded)

  • Fast transient recovery with minimal distortion


Interfaces



  • Front panel: 4× BNC connectors (2 inputs, 2 outputs)

  • Rear panel: DB15/M SIM interface connector for power and overload monitoring


Compatibility & Integration The SIM914 integrates directly into the Stanford Research Systems SIM900 Mainframe or operates standalone with external +5 V DC power supply.
